TICKET-4412: Config drift on TideGlance widget

Prod and staging disagree on the TideGlance tide-table widget. Staging shows six-hour intervals; prod shows four. Nobody changed the repo, so someone edited prod by hand. New folks: never patch prod directly — update the manifest in the tideglance-config repo. Current prod values for reference are below.

deployment values, tawif-bajef:
[lamath]
port = 8443
team = ruswyn
host = lamath.plorvatech.corp
region = west-1
access_code = ac_38ff71
timeout_ms = 750

TURN-208: Gatevale turnstile counters at the Merrow Field pilot double-count when a rotation reverses mid-cycle. Attendance totals drift roughly 2% high per event. The debounce window fix is implemented, reviewed by Ilsa, and soak-tested across two simulated match days without drift. Ready for your cut; the candidate build is identified below.

trace token, tagag-tafog: htk6_5ed18c

Before the Brindlemoor District's solver release can be signed, confirm that both ceremony witnesses from the Quillhaven team have initialed the attendance sheet and that the hardware token for the Chalkline scheduling engine is present and untampered. As the new contractor, you will read the recovery material aloud exactly once while the recorder transcribes it; do not paraphrase. Verify the seal number matches the log, then proceed. The recovery passphrase to be read is as follows.

unlock words, hahip-yagef: zorok-novmir-zorix-silax

Rounding errors in Tillgate's currency conversion almost always come from double-converting through the ledger cache. Before changing anything, confirm the discrepancy is under one minor unit per transaction; larger gaps mean a stale rate table, which is a different runbook. Always round once, at display time, using banker's rounding, and never mutate stored minor-unit amounts. The full worked examples and the rate-table refresh steps live on this internal page.

runbook for tajep-yahig: https://artifactory.lumictech.corp/repo